What's Happening?
Boston Celtics head coach Joe Mazzulla has been recognized as the Eastern Conference Coach of the Month for December. This marks the fifth time Mazzulla has received this honor in his four-year tenure with the Celtics. Under his leadership, the team achieved a 9-3 record in December and began 2026 with a significant victory over the Sacramento Kings. The Celtics currently hold a 21-12 record, placing them third in the Eastern Conference, just two games behind the second-place New York Knicks. Mazzulla's coaching has been instrumental in the Celtics exceeding expectations this season.
